Oklo Inc. (NYSE:OKLO) designs and builds advanced small-modular fission reactors aimed at delivering clean, reliable, and cost-effective electricity to U.S. customers, while also commercializing a proprietary nuclear-fuel-recycling process that turns spent fuel into usable reactor fuel. The company is headquartered in Santa Clara, California, and is classified under the Electric Utilities sub-industry.

Key Metric Definitions

  • Dividend Yield: Annual dividend per share divided by current share price.
  • Dividend Growth Rate: Compound annual growth rate of annual dividend per share over the last 5 years.
  • Payout Ratio: Percentage of earnings paid as dividends (TTM).
  • Payout Consistency: % of eligible periods with uninterrupted or increased dividends, measured over the entire lifetime of the stock or fund.
  • Payout Frequency: Number of dividends paid in the last 12m (TTM).
  • Overall Dividend Rating: Proprietary composite score, quantified on a scale from 0 to +100. Ratings surpassing 70 are regarded as favorable, while those exceeding 85 are strong.
  • Total Return: Price appreciation plus dividends over specified period.
